| Course Description | This session is designed for the seasoned X3 users and those newer to X3 that have a good, general understanding of work orders who are looking to make efficiency gains by employing a planning and scheduling process. We will cover the basics of planning and scheduling and strategies to increase efficiency through better work order management. The X3 Scheduler is then covered in detail, including different ways to use the calendar and how to quickly create and modify work schedules. |
| Course Prerequisites | Overview, Work Order Management Level 1 |
| Who Should Attend | Anyone who would plan and/or schedule work orders. |
